Error Bounds for Laminar Boundary Layer Solutions.
Abstract
The research is concerned with determining error bounds for approximate solutions of the Prandtl boundary layer equations. The error bounds are determined by applying the theory of differential inequalities. The approximate solutions are of the weighted-residual type and the boundary layer cases studied include both similar and nonsimilar, two-dimensional laminar, incompressible, steady flows.
